Had Scarff ahead 116-112, scrappy at times, a lot of spoiling and mauling, both were guilty of smothering their work, Scarff switched constantly but done a lot better in the middle rounds when he kept that distance and tagged Essuman with the straight and looping right hands, Essuman is tough, hard to hit clean , doesn't land clean often it has to be said but he is strong and super fit, just keeps trudging forward, both men were tired in the later rounds and started to take cleaner shots, Scarff landed the better shots though and deserved it
